In a remarkable historical example, during the Cold War, the Swiss government constructed a network of nuclear fallout shelters across the country to safeguard its citizens in the event of a nuclear war. These shelters were strategically positioned in natural surroundings, specifically mountainsides, to take full advantage of the natural barriers offered by the Swiss Alps. This infrastructure represented the significance placed on utilizing natural barriers to ensure the safety of the population during times of nuclear threat.

Communication and Warning Systems
Effective communication and warning systems, such as the Emergency Broadcast System (EBS), Wireless Emergency Alerts (WEA), Public Address Systems, Sirens, Emergency Alert System (EAS), and the Local Emergency Management Agency, play a vital role in nuclear preparedness. These systems ensure the timely dissemination of information to ensure the safety of individuals during a nuclear strike. To visualize the key components of these systems, a well-designed
System | Description |
---|---|
Emergency Broadcast System (EBS) | Broadcasts emergency information through radio, TV, and cable systems |
Wireless Emergency Alerts (WEA) | Sends emergency messages to mobile devices in a specific area |
Public Address Systems | Uses speakers to broadcast emergency messages in public places |
Sirens | Produces loud warning sounds to alert individuals in the affected area |
Emergency Alert System (EAS) | Delivers emergency messages through radio and TV broadcast stations |
Local Emergency Management Agency | Coordinates emergency response efforts at the local level |

Frequently Asked Questions
What is mutually assured destruction (MAD) and how does it relate to nuclear war?
Mutually assured destruction (MAD) is a doctrine that dictates the use of nuclear weapons. It means that if one country launches a nuclear attack, the other will retaliate until no one is left alive. This doctrine aims to deter countries from initiating a nuclear strike, as the consequences would be catastrophic for both sides.
What is an alpha strike and why is it significant in the context of nuclear warfare?
An alpha strike is a preemptive attack on the enemy’s nuclear weapons and military assets. It aims to disable the opponent’s ability to retaliate with nuclear weapons. The concept of an alpha strike is significant because it can potentially prevent a devastating counterattack and give the attacking country a strategic advantage in a nuclear conflict.

What are the opinions of experts regarding the preparedness of these targeted cities for a nuclear attack?
Public-health expert Irwin Redlener believes that none of the targeted cities in the United States, including New York, Chicago, Houston, Los Angeles, San Francisco, and Washington, DC, have adequate plans to deal with a nuclear detonation. This highlights the importance of improving preparedness and response strategies for such disaster scenarios.
